Sony SNC-Z20P colour video network camera
Sony Ipela SNC-Z20P video camera with integrated auto-focus 18x optical zoom, gives superb picture quality and can zoom in on small or distance objects with exceptional clarity.
The camera, with built-in web server, connects to your TCP/IP network allowing you to access the video from anywhere on the network using a standard web browser on your PC optional Sony IMZ-RS Series Monitoring Software. You can connect to any Local Area Network (LAN), and it can stream up to 25 frames per second of images in VGA 640x480 resolution for smooth moving images.
Supporting all standard network protocols, installing this camera is an easy task by simply connecting the Ethernet cable to any TCP/IP Network. The supplied set-up software makes it possible to start monitoring within minutes after you installed the camera. Installation can be made even easier using a single cable for both power and data transmission.

Features
IP network colour video camera with integrated 18x optical zoom lens for excellent resolution of fine detail
1/4 type CCD sensor with ExWaveHAD technology for high sensitivity 0.7 lux in colour mode, 0,01 1x (F1.4, 50 IRE, Slow shutter OFF) in B/W mode
Power over Ethernet allows power to be supplied via Ethernet CAT5 cable (cable not supplied)
Added functionality via on-board PC card slot for onboard event storage or optional wireless LAN for greater installation flexibility
Day/night function switches to black and white mode in low light conditions
PAL composite video output for local analogue viewing or recording
Optional extra wide angle conversion lens (VCL-0637H)
Specification
Camera: Image device 1/4 type Interline Transfer CCD with Exwave HAD technology
Number of effective pixels (H x V) 752 x 582
Electronic shutter 1 to 1/10 000 s
Exposure Auto [Full Auto (including backlight compensation), Shutter-priority, Iris-priority] and manual
White balance Auto, ATW, Indoor, Outdoor, One-push, Manual
EV compensation -1.75 to +1.75 EV (15 steps)
Iris Auto/Manual (F1.4 to close)
Gain Auto/Manual (-3 dB to +28 dB)
Focus mode Auto/Manual (Near, Far, One-push, Auto-focus)
Lens: Type Auto-focus zoom lens
Zoom ratio 18x optical, 216x with digital zoom
Focal length f = 4.1 mm to 73.8 mm
Horizontal viewing angle 48° (wide) to 2.7° (tele)
F-number F1.4 (wide), F3.0 (tele)
Minimum object distance 10 mm (wide), 800 mm (tele)
System/Network: CPU 32-bit RISC processor
RAM 32 MB (includes 8-MB alarm buffer)
Flash memory 8 MB
Image size (H x V) 736 x 544, 640 x 480, 320 x 240, 160 x 120
Compression JPEG
Compression ratio 1/5 to 1/60 (10 steps)
Frame rate Max. 25 fps (640 x 480)
Protocols TCP/IP, ARP, ICMP, HTTP, FTP, SMTP, DHCP, DNS, NTP, and SNMP (MIB-2)
Interface: Ethernet 100Base-TX/10Base-T (RJ-45)
PC card slot 1 x PCMCIA Type II
Video output Analogue composite (1 x BNC), 1.0 Vp-p, 75ohm, unbalanced, sync negative
Sensor in 1
Alarm out 2
Serial interface RS-232C (transparency function or VISCA protocol)
Analogue video output
Signal system PAL
Sync system Internal
Horizontal resolution 460 TV lines
S/N ratio More than 50 dB (AGC OFF, Weight ON)
Minimum illumination 0.7 lx (F1.4, 50 IRE, Colour, Slow shutter OFF)
0.01 lx (F1.4, 50 IRE, B/W, Slow shutter OFF)
General: Mass 800 g (1 lb. 12 oz.)
Dimensions 80 x 77 x 177 mm: (W x H x D)
Power requirements DC 12 V, AC 24 V, or Power over Ethernet IEEE 802.3af
Power consumption 9 W
Operating temperature 0 °C to 40 °C (32 °F to 104 °F)
Storage temperature -20 °C to +60 °C (-4 °F to +140 °F)
Operating humidity 20% to 80%, Non-condensing
Storage humidity 20% to 95%, Non-condensing
System Requirements: Operating system Microsoft® Windows® 98/98SE/ME/NT4.0/2000/XP
Processor Intel® Pentium® III, 500 MHz or higher
(Intel Pentium 4, 1 GHz or higher recommended)
Memory 128 MB RAM minimum
Display 1024 x 768, true colour or more
